Hotel Caribe Plaza Barranquilla is strategically located in the El Prado neighborhood, offering a mix of comfort and convenience. This 3-star hotel is known for its welcoming atmosphere and proximity to commercial and cultural landmarks. Guests benefit from complimentary services like breakfast and WiFi.
Location
The hotel is conveniently situated just 6 miles from Ernesto Cortissoz International Airport and is within walking distance of cultural attractions like the Barranquilla Zoo and Casa de Carnaval. Its prime location in El Prado offers easy access to the city's commercial sector, ensuring guests can explore the best of Barranquilla effortlessly.
Rooms
Each room at the Hotel Caribe Plaza is air-conditioned and features modern amenities such as flat-screen TVs with cable channels. Rooms include minibars and private bathrooms equipped with rainfall showerheads and complimentary toiletries. The hotel offers various accommodation options, including single, double, and family rooms catering to diverse guest needs.
Eat & Drink
The hotel's on-site restaurant, Cohiba, serves a full American breakfast daily and features a diverse menu of international and Colombian cuisine. Guests can enjoy meals in a comfortable setting or opt for room service. A snack bar is available for lighter fare throughout the day.
Leisure & Business
The Hotel Caribe Plaza provides a range of amenities for both leisure and business travelers. Guests can utilize the conference center and meeting rooms, totaling 796 square feet of space. Additional amenities include a business center, complimentary wireless internet, and 24-hour front desk service.
